Purchased this 2003 100 series about 3 months ago. 215k on the clock. Rust Free...
u3IkXaT.jpg


-Recently after about 1000 mile trip on the way home the ABS alarm went off. And again this week while driving locally.
-Now the ABS VSC and Brake lights are lit.
-She's Parked in the Driveway.

Got out the Techstream and pulled the codes.

Yes, sounds like time for a new master assembly. Order the Toyota fluid while you are at it.
 
Is your brake fluid level low? Be sure to follow the procedure to properly check. I think it’s on the cap, also detailed out in the forum but it’s something like turn off car and press pedal about 40x.

Quick look through FSM attached.
My thoughts are best case you’ve got low fluid level or a sensor issue.
Also is the audible alarm on at this point?

Fluid is not low.

Ran through the check, pumped it 40 times, timed the motor run it was under 40 seconds.

The alarm comes on every once in a while. Not constant.

The Light used to come a go, but now are on steady now.
 
Fwiw I had a similar issue last year. I flushed the fluid and the issue hasn’t come back yet knock on wood.

I’m planning more frequent flushes just to be safe.
